Try to have a notebook to write your lyrics down.Doodles are a great way to remember your lyrics with drawings, patterns and shapes of the letters.The process of writing lyrics, perhaps more than any other discipline in music, is very personal to the writer. Everyone has a different approach, and what will work well for one lyricist will not necessarily work for another. Some people can write a whole song in five minutes, for some people it can take months.Some write the lyrics first, some the chord progression, and others a melody. Some might start with a title and build from there and others may start with an emotion or a personal event that they want to share through the art of song. All of these methods are perfect for writing songs. As we share our tips on how to write a song for beginners.

The music to the jingle should be appropriate to the product. You won’t write upbeat music for a jingle about auto accident insurance, but you would write something upbeat for a child’s toy. Whether you are humming your jingle, singing it or writing with an instrument, choose a musical tone that complements your product appropriately.

How To Write A Song, Exercise 1 (for beginners, or for writer's block): Write a letter to someone you feel intensely about something you feel intensely about. If you don't feel intensely about anyone or anything, pretend you are someone else: a character from a book, a play, or a painting, or someone else you know.
